Jon Sumrall, the newly appointed head coach of the Florida Gators, has already found himself at the center of a social media storm. The buzz erupted after it was revealed that Sumrall canceled a planned trip to Italy for his 15-year wedding anniversary to focus on his new role. This decision has sparked a lively debate among college football fans online.

Sumrall, known for his strong work ethic and commitment to building competitive teams, has received praise within football circles. However, the news of him prioritizing his job over a significant personal milestone has drawn mixed reactions. Some fans see it as a testament to his dedication to the program, while others question the personal sacrifices involved.

Initially, Sumrall had planned the Italy trip to celebrate the anniversary with his wife. But after accepting the Florida job, he chose to cancel the trip, fully committing to the responsibilities of leading one of college football’s premier programs. This decision has fueled a broader discussion about work-life balance in the sport.

As the story gained traction on social media, fan reactions varied widely. Some criticized the decision, suggesting it sent the wrong message about personal priorities. Comments ranged from concerns about marital strain to opinions on the necessity of maintaining a balance between professional and personal life.

One commenter noted, "Wife gonna file for divorce bro," while another added, "That’s honestly sad." Others highlighted the intense pressure within the SEC, with one fan stating, “Most SEC fans are toxic and will harass him if he isn’t excellent.”

Some fans pointed to other successful coaches who prioritize family time, arguing that constant presence in the office isn't necessary for success. “Family first, man,” one comment read, while another suggested, “You can still celebrate with your wife while being focused on your fans and players.”

Despite differing opinions, the situation underscores the immense pressure and expectations tied to major college football roles. For Sumrall, stepping into the spotlight at Florida has meant that even personal choices are now part of the public discourse.
